5 V fixed LDO — 1 A continuous with 0.8 V dropout

The Texas Instruments LP38692MPX-5.0/NOPB is a single-output positive linear regulator delivering a fixed 5 V at up to 1 A continuous. Quiescent current is 55 µA typical, with a maximum supply current of 100 µA — low enough for always-on rails in battery-backed or standby circuits where the regulator's own draw must not dominate the system budget.

Industrial temperature grade and thermal management

The SOT-223-5 package (TO-261-5 equivalent) has an exposed pad on the bottom — the primary thermal path for the 1 A output. Board layout must connect this pad to a copper plane to keep the junction temperature within the operating range at full load. Built-in over-temperature protection shuts the die down under sustained overload or high ambient; the part cycles off and on until the fault clears. No over-current or reverse-voltage protection is integrated — external circuitry is required if those failure modes are expected.

PSRR and ripple rejection in signal-chain rails

Power-supply rejection ratio is 55 dB at 120 Hz — this is the line-frequency ripple rejection figure. Above the crossover frequency the PSRR rolls off; upstream switching noise above a few hundred kHz will pass through unless filtered ahead of the LDO.

What is the PSRR of LP38692MPX-5.0/NOPB and why does it matter?

The PSRR is 55 dB at 120 Hz. This means the regulator attenuates line-frequency ripple from a rectified AC input by a factor of about 560×. For a 5 V rail feeding an analog or RF signal chain, this rejection keeps the supply clean enough to avoid injecting hum into the signal path.
